Cool pictures. I was there about a year ago. Now I like like 2 hours away! But I like how they change the donuts street flags every year. Personally I'm not a fan of the area. It's a bit boring and the military guys who are stationed in the area make it so foreigners who visit the area aren't looked at as kindly. There are sailors just like Shenmue, but instead of 4 or 5 there are about 50 of them that walk the streets drunk at night causing trouble.
